For people who have yet to experience Tremor and are considering dipping their toe in the festival, the first question to leave their mouth is: “Is it true that you went to see a concert on another island?”. Not only is this true, but the aforementioned concert was a concert by the shamans of Brazilian tropic-neo-psychedelic, Boogarins, in the humble bandstand in Vila do Porto (on the island of Santa Maria), right before everyone went to eat a turnip broth and biscoitos de orelha. Laurinda Sousa, the Mariense who helped organize this adventure, remembers this day in 2018:
«My most vivid memory is that, even before the concert, the bus that had come from the airport stopped at Poço da Pedreira and it was a wonderful day and all you could hear was the sound of frogs. And, as people got off the bus, the crowd started sitting on the grass, all in silence, just to hear that ambient sound. They were in an almost ecstatic state. On the other hand, I also remember how difficult it was for people to leave to go watch the concert because nobody really wanted to leave. This trip to Santa Maria will always be remembered as one of the greatest mad and challenging things Tremor has done.»
